Kim knew in advance that the runway season is brutally demanding when she first started in Antwerp a year ago, as a  showroom model for cult Belgian designer Jurgi Peersons. She liked the family-like environment of the showroom, the quiet pace, the familiar faces. But destiny (in the form of Vision Models) came calling and then came the insider connections at New York Models and subsequently Kim's killer NY show season. Now here she is marching day in, day out to the  beat beat beat of fashion that somehow presumes the model is a indefatigable machine.


Decency insists we should just let Kim go home and rest  but there are the demands of the job. All this bric-a-brac and madness makes for a provocative editorial layout  but there is no cover shot here, not unless we want  Marilyn Manson and Greta Garbo sharing the backdrop with Miss Peers.
And we can't let her go  because Kim right now is white-hot. Everything she has been shooting  has looked incredible and not "incredible" in that polite way but incredible in a trend setting way.
